Ranbir Kapoor Reveals His Biggest Fear Before Playing Lord Rama In Ramayana: “Am I Capable Enough?”

Must read

- Advertisement -

Ranbir Kapoor is taking one of the most significant roles of his career to the global stage as he promotes Ramayana. The actor joined co-star Yash, director Nitesh Tiwari and producer Namit Malhotra at San Diego Comic-Con on Thursday for a special panel dedicated to the highly anticipated epic.

During the discussion, Ranbir opened up about the emotional journey of portraying Lord Rama, revealing that his first reaction to the offer was filled with fear, self-doubt and a deep sense of responsibility.

Ranbir Kapoor Opens Up About His Initial Doubts

Recalling the moment he was offered the role, Ranbir admitted he questioned whether he was the right person to bring one of India’s most revered figures to the big screen.

“I remember when the film was first offered to me, there was so much of fear, so much of doubt. ‘Will I be able to do this, am I capable enough?’ But I think that doubt changed into gratitude very early on. I think it was a blessing, an opportunity of a lifetime, and a moral responsibility. The Ramayana is ingrained in our subconscious. Lord Rama is the conscience keeper of millions of people around the world for generations, for more than 4000 years. He is somebody who embodies the triumph of the human spirit in times of adversities. He stands for courage, compassion, forgiveness, righteousness, and just to have the opportunity to represent that is very daunting.”

“It Requires Faith, Truthfulness and Noble Intentions”

The actor said he soon realised that playing Lord Rama was not about achieving perfection but about approaching the character with sincerity, honesty and faith.

According to Ranbir, everyone associated with the project shares a common vision of presenting the timeless story with authenticity.

“Very early on, I understood that it just requires lot of faith, lot of belief, lot of truthfulness, and noble intentions. Our entire cast and crew had one noble intention, and that is to tell the story as authentically as we can.”

Yash Praises Ranbir Kapoor’s Casting as Lord Rama

During the Comic-Con panel, Yash, who portrays Ravana in the film, also spoke about Ranbir’s casting and said his humility made him the perfect choice for the role.

The actor praised Ranbir’s understanding of the responsibility that comes with portraying Lord Rama.

“Nobody in this world can come and say, ‘I have the virtue to play Lord Rama’. The fact that he (Ranbir) said the same says it all. He is a fabulous actor. It’s not easy to play Lord Rama and the way he has really worked, huge respect to him.”

Ramayana Release Date

Directed by Nitesh Tiwari, Ramayana will be released as a two-part cinematic epic.

  • Part One: Diwali 2026
  • Part Two: Diwali 2027

The film features an ensemble cast led by Ranbir Kapoor as Lord Rama, Sai Pallavi as Sita, and Yash as Ravana. Other prominent cast members include Ravie Dubey, Sunny Deol, Rakul Preet Singh, Lara Dutta, Arun Govil, Vivek Oberoi, and Kunal Kapoor.

With its global launch at San Diego Comic-Con and a star-studded cast, Ramayana is shaping up to be one of the biggest Indian film releases in recent years.
